你用的是office 2000吧,如果换成office 2003在引用里选择microsoft exceo object11就可以了,不过office2003好像不怎么稳定。

解决方案 »

  1.   

    遇到过类似的问题,正如楼上所说的,是版本问题
    而且,不止是这样,OS的版本也有关系
    我最近在做的那个EXCEL导入导出的东西就是这样,WIN2000上编译一点问题没有,WINXP上就不行了
      

  2.   


    我用2003 的microsoft exceo object11引用不过在本机上运行好用,可是用到别人的机器是XP就不好用了。
      

  3.   

    我用的是.net 2003 + office 2000,奇怪是另外一台机器上装的是相同的版本的东西,竟然没问题
      

  4.   

    有人知道那个版本是没有问题的吗?我的操作系统是Win2K,Excel是Office 2k里的,版本号是
    9.0.2812,谢谢
      

  5.   

    我重新安装了操作系统和VISUAL 2003,OFFICE 2K后依然如此:D:\t>tlbimp excel9.olb
    Microsoft (R) .NET Framework Type Library to Assembly Converter 1.1.4322.573
    Copyright (C) Microsoft Corporation 1998-2002.  All rights reserved.TlbImp warning: 导入类型时出错:参数引用了不可用的类型库(类型:_Application;参
    数:RHS;方法:get_VBE)。
    TlbImp warning: 类型 _Application 无效,可能只能进行部分转换。
    TlbImp warning: 导入类型时出错:参数引用了不可用的类型库(类型:_Workbook;参数:
    RHS;方法:get_VBProject)。
    TlbImp warning: 类型 _Workbook 无效,可能只能进行部分转换。
    TlbImp warning: 导入类型时出错:参数引用了不可用的类型库(类型:Application;参数
    :RHS;方法:get_VBE)。
    TlbImp warning: 类型 Application 无效,可能只能进行部分转换。
    TlbImp warning: 导入类型时出错:参数引用了不可用的类型库(类型:Workbook;参数:R
    HS;方法:get_VBProject)。
    TlbImp warning: 类型 Workbook 无效,可能只能进行部分转换。
    Type library imported to Excel.dll谁可以告诉我解决的方法?谢谢